Hi all
My lo is 2 1/2 and yesterday we took the plunge and finally dropped his morning bottle. Not sure on 2 things; what to give him first thing in the morning instead and where I add the extra calcium into his meals, he eats yoghurts, cheese and has milk on cereal.
Thanks

Mine has a cup of milk first thing in the morning then breakfast later (ditched the bottle at 13 months but continued the milk).  He also has half a cup of milk at supper, before going up for this bath and bed. Those plus cheese and any dairy in cooking. I consider that enough. I am considering moving the morning milk drink though to snack time because the nursery I have registered him to start after he is 3 offer milk and snack mid morning and I wouldn't need him to have two milk drinks in the morning (it would be nice if he drank the milk mid morning to be the same as the other kids yk - although it's not that big a deal). If you have a nursery in mind for when he is 3 maybe you can ask them when/if they offer milk.  I think reception classes still give a milk drink too.
